I'm thinking of processing Masters in Holland just worried about getting job after I graduate and staying back �, any reason why you think Holland is Worth being looked in


International graduates can apply for permanent residency once they can prove 5 years of lawful residence along with sufficient Dutch language skills and knowledge about Dutch culture.

And

According to a survey conducted by EM among international students attending EUR, [b]more than 60 per cent [/b]of these international students expect to have 'difficulty' or 'great difficulty' finding a job in the Netherlands

So automatically no job waiting for you anywhere unless you lucky...

EU countries system is more related to each others unlike Canada and Australia that gives out more work permit after studies...

But still... Holland is a very nice place to study... and just stay focus and start connecting with your colleagues and professors from day1 of resumption..

I'm sure you will get a good newtork
